Legal Services 24/7: How Digitalization Makes Law More Accessible for Everyone
In today's fast-paced world, where information is just a click away and services are available around the clock, the legal industry is also adapting to meet the changing needs of consumers. The digitalization of legal services has made law more accessible for everyone, breaking down traditional barriers and providing opportunities for individuals and businesses to seek legal advice and assistance anytime, anywhere.
One of the key advantages of digitalization in the legal sector is the ability to access legal services 24/7. In the past, seeking legal advice meant scheduling appointments, traveling to law offices, and waiting for responses to emails or phone calls. With digital platforms and tools, individuals can now connect with lawyers and legal professionals at any time of the day, making it easier to address urgent legal matters and receive timely guidance.
Online legal services have also democratized access to legal information and resources. Through legal websites, blogs, and online forums, individuals can now educate themselves on various legal topics, understand their rights and responsibilities, and explore different legal options available to them. This wealth of information helps empower individuals to make informed decisions and take proactive steps to protect their legal interests.
Moreover, digitalization has facilitated the automation of routine legal tasks, making legal services more efficient and cost-effective. Document preparation, contract review, case research, and other standard legal processes can now be automated using legal software and artificial intelligence, saving time and reducing the need for manual intervention. This not only streamlines the delivery of legal services but also lowers the overall cost, making legal assistance more affordable and accessible to a broader audience.
Virtual law firms and online legal platforms have further expanded the reach of legal services, enabling individuals and businesses to connect with lawyers from different geographical locations and legal specialties. This virtual marketplace of legal professionals allows clients to compare services, read reviews, and select the right lawyer for their specific needs, creating a competitive environment that drives innovation and improves the quality of legal services offered.
In conclusion, the digitalization of legal services has transformed the way in which legal assistance is delivered and accessed by individuals and businesses. By providing 24/7 availability, democratizing legal information, automating routine tasks, and expanding the pool of legal professionals, digital platforms have made law more accessible, efficient, and cost-effective for everyone. As technology continues to advance, the legal industry will undoubtedly evolve further, creating new opportunities and possibilities for improving the delivery of legal services to meet the needs of a digital age.
